7-Day Itinerary: Exploring Istanbul

Thursday, August 24: Arrival in Istanbul

Welcome to Istanbul! Start your journey by checking into your hotel and getting settled. In the morning, take a stroll through Sultanahmet Square, where you'll find iconic landmarks like the Blue Mosque and Hagia Sophia. In the afternoon, explore the bustling Grand Bazaar, a vibrant marketplace offering a wide range of goods. As the evening approaches, sample delicious Turkish cuisine at a local restaurant.

  • Sultanahmet Square: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Grand Bazaar: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Dinner at a local restaurant: $10-20 per person
Friday, August 25: Historical Gems

Discover the rich history of Istanbul today. Start your morning at Topkapi Palace, the former residence of Ottoman sultans. In the afternoon, visit the Basilica Cistern, an underground marvel featuring ancient columns and atmospheric lighting. As the sun sets, take a leisurely cruise along the Bosphorus Strait to enjoy breathtaking views of Istanbul's skyline.

  • Topkapi Palace: $10-15, 2-3 hours
  • Basilica Cistern: $6-8, 1-2 hours
  • Bosphorus Cruise: $20-30, 2-3 hours
Saturday, August 26: Modern Istanbul

Experience the vibrant and modern side of Istanbul today. Start your morning with a visit to Istiklal Avenue, a bustling pedestrian street lined with shops, cafes, and street performers. In the afternoon, explore the trendy neighborhood of Beyoglu and visit the Istanbul Modern Art Museum. As the evening unfolds, head to Taksim Square, a bustling hub of nightlife and entertainment.

  • Istiklal Avenue: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Istanbul Modern Art Museum: $10-15, 2-3 hours
  • Taksim Square: Free, evening
Sunday, August 27: Asian Side Adventure

Take a trip to the Asian side of Istanbul today. Start your morning by crossing the Bosphorus Bridge to Kadikoy, a lively neighborhood known for its vibrant markets and delicious street food. In the afternoon, explore the historic district of Uskudar and visit the iconic Maiden's Tower. As the sun sets, enjoy a leisurely stroll along the waterfront promenade.

  • Kadikoy: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Uskudar: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Maiden's Tower: $5-10, 1-2 hours
Monday, August 28: Princes' Islands Escape

Escape the bustling city and venture to the Princes' Islands today. Take a ferry to Büyükada, the largest of the islands, and explore its charming streets by horse-drawn carriage or bicycle. Enjoy a leisurely picnic by the seaside or indulge in fresh seafood at one of the local restaurants. In the afternoon, hike to the top of Büyükada Hill for panoramic views.

  • Ferry to Büyükada: $10-15 round trip, 1.5-2 hours
  • Horse-drawn carriage or bicycle rental: $10-20, 3-4 hours
  • Hiking to Büyükada Hill: Free, 1-2 hours
Tuesday, August 29: Ottoman Heritage

Immerse yourself in the Ottoman heritage of Istanbul today. Start your morning at the Dolmabahce Palace, a magnificent waterfront palace known for its opulent interiors. In the afternoon, visit the Chora Church, renowned for its stunning Byzantine mosaics and frescoes. As the evening sets in, take a relaxing Turkish bath at one of the traditional hammams.

  • Dolmabahce Palace: $10-15, 2-3 hours
  • Chora Church: $6-8, 1-2 hours
  • Turkish Bath: $20-30, 1-2 hours
Wednesday, August 30: Farewell Istanbul

On your last day in Istanbul, take some time to revisit your favorite spots or explore any attractions you may have missed. In the afternoon, indulge in a delightful Turkish tea or coffee at a local cafe. As the sun sets, head to the Galata Tower for panoramic views of the city and bid farewell to Istanbul.

  • Revisit favorite spots: Free, time varies
  • Turkish tea or coffee: $3-5, 1-2 hours
  • Galata Tower: $7-10, 1-2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

When exploring Istanbul, don't miss the hidden gem of Balat, a colorful neighborhood known for its picturesque streets and charming cafes. Another local favorite is the Kadikoy Food Market, where you can taste a wide variety of delicious Turkish delicacies. For a peaceful escape, visit the tranquil Emirgan Park, famous for its beautiful tulip gardens.
